West Norwalk offers spacious residential neighborhoods with charming homes on large lots and tree-lined avenues. This side of town is mainly residential, but you’ll find restaurants, big-box stores, supermarkets, and more along Interstate 95 nearby. The interstate and other major roads in the area will take you closer to Downtown Norwalk. Amenities nearby include the Maritime Aquarium at Norwalk and Matthews Park. Local restaurants and shops await in the heart of the city as well. For a vibrant nightlife scene, locals travel just a few miles west into Downtown Stamford.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
